Discover top Colorado Springs (and vicinity) attractions with your pet
For travelers with pets, the greater Colorado Springs area is a paradise of adventures. Start your journey at the stunning Garden of the Gods, where you and your furry friend can roam through miles of pet-friendly trails, taking in the breathtaking red rock formations and vibrant wildflowers. Next, head to the Manitou Incline – a challenging climb that rewards you with spectacular views (be sure to check pet policies as some areas may have restrictions). For a more relaxed outing, the Palmer Park offers extensive open spaces and trails perfect for a leisurely stroll with your pet. Additionally, consider visiting the Cheyenne Mountain Zoo, which welcomes leashed pets on certain days, allowing you to explore this unique mountainside zoo together. Finally, the nearby Pikes Peak provides a scenic backdrop for a day of exploration, with numerous trails that welcome pets as you take in the fresh mountain air. For accommodations, look into the charming Old Colorado City area, where pet-friendly hotels offer cozy stays with delightful local shops and eateries just a short walk away, ensuring both you and your pet feel pampered during your visit.
